DANNY WORSNOP

DANNY WORSNOP HAS done and seen it all. The frontman helped put British metalcore on the map in the late 00s with hellraisers Asking Alexandria, only to quit the band in 2015 then rejoin two years later. He’s veered into debauched hard rock with his side-project We Are Harlot and launched a stripped-down country/blues solo career, and we’ve watched him live every one of his Sunset Strip fantasies before finally finding sobriety and happiness. Now, as Asking Alexandria’s seventh album, See What’s On The Inside, drops, he looks back at what he’s learned during his rollercoaster career.
